What You'll Do:
Develop and deploy AI/ML models to enhance clinical workflows, including call routing, prioritization, escalation, and automation
Design predictive and analytical models to support staff allocation optimization, alarm fatigue reduction, and patient response prioritization
Build and integrate AI capabilities into enterprise data and analytics platforms, leveraging aggregated workflow and clinical system data
Integrate AI capabilities within Rauland’s interoperability ecosystem, including nurse call systems, medical devices, and EHR platforms
Develop intelligent services for event correlation, context-aware alerting, and workflow optimization across connected systems
Design and implement scalable AI deployment pipelines, including model lifecycle management, monitoring, and drift detection
Ensure secure and compliant handling of healthcare data aligned with regulatory and hospital requirements
Collaborate cross-functionally with Software Engineering, Product Management, Clinical teams, and field organizations to translate prototypes into production-ready features
Contribute to product roadmap initiatives focused on AI-enabled workflow automation and next-generation clinical communication platforms
Do You Have...
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ning, or related field or an equivalent combination of education and relevant experience
5+ years of experience in machine learning, data engineering, or AI solution development
Strong proficiency in Python, SQL, and modern machine learning frameworks (e.g., TensorFlow, PyTorch)
Experience working with real-time systems, time-series data, or event-driven architectures
Experience integrating systems through APIs and distributed architectures
Strong understanding of software engineering best practices, including testing, scalability, and performance optimization
What About These... Even Better!
Experience in healthcare IT systems, clinical workflows, or regulated environments
Familiarity with interoperability standards such as HL7, FHIR, or similar healthcare protocols
Experience with cloud-based analytics platforms and hybrid or on-prem deployments
Exposure to MLOps practices, model deployment pipelines, and lifecycle management
Understanding of explainable AI and model governance in regulated domains
